And Is Phi is a multidisciplinary artist based in South East London via Norway and the Philippines. After making music for over a decade through a plethora of collaborations she dropped her debut album ‘Double Pink’. This body of work offers a soulful, left field, and reflective exploration of liminal spaces, metamorphosis, and the multiple faces of love.
The album received acclaim from Dazed and the Guardian, with radio play from BBC radio, Jazz FM, and Soho Radio. She performed the project live at the Southbank Centre, Stroud Jazz Festival, Brick Lane Festival, and We Out Here.
A few seasons later she released her EP ‘Twice Blushed’, featuring remixes by Wonky Logic, Footshooter, Marysia Osu, a flip by D'Vo (Tilé Gichigi-Lipére), and new work with Hector Plimmer. The EP is a reimagining and extension of the Double Pink universe, explored through a much heavier electronically driven landscape.
She’s also a painter, illustrator, curator, and educator of Art & Design. Moving between singing, writing, and visual art offers an inter-weaving of creative conversation that at its heart all contribute to her practice of ‘world building’.
At present her new work in the making, both visually and sonically, are exploring themes of living in a time of depression and great social and political shifting. Somewhere between the strife and supernatural magic of everyday life is an invitation to imagine our next steps.
